摘要

Upland cotton (G hirsutum L.) is one of the most important fibre crops in the world. A majority of the present-day commercial cotton varieties belong to upland cotton, a few to G. barbadense and some to diploid species (G. herbaceum and G arboreuni).A large number of polymorphic markers are required to measure genetic relationships a genetic diversity in a reliable manfier. Morphological features are indicative of the genotype but are affected by environmental conditions and growth practices, On thecontrary, DNA markers such as RAPD (Williams et al, 1990; Welsh and Clelland, 1990) are not influenced by the environmental, conditions and provide unlimited number of marker loci which can be used for various purposes, including the study of genetic relatedness, varietal purity and protection of Plant Breeders' Rights. RAPD markers have been successfully used for diversity analysis ini cotton ;(Multani and Lyon, 1995; Tatineni et al 1996; Iqbal et al. 1997; Rana and Bhat, 2002). In, the present investigation, genetic diversity using morphological and RAPD markers was assessed in cotton.
